position = PremiersThe Huonville Lions Football Club is an
Australian rules football club currently playing in theSouthern Football League (Tasmania) , also known as the SFL Regional League, inTasmania, Australia .
Origins
The Huonville Lions were formed as a result of a merger between former Huon Football Association clubs Huonville Bulldogs (formed 1887) and the Franklin Lions (formed 1887) at the end of the 1997 season after the Huon Football Association's demise.
The Lions then joined the SFL in 1998
